久久r热视频,国产午夜精品一区二区三区视频,亚洲精品自拍偷拍,欧美日韩精品二区

您的位置:首頁(yè)技術(shù)文章
文章詳情頁(yè)

node.js - 在vuejs-templates/webpack中dev-server.js里為什么要exports readyPromise?

瀏覽:110日期:2023-08-26 08:41:35

問題描述

看源碼dev-server.js只有在package.json 里被node.js調(diào)用,如下:

'start': 'node build/dev-server.js',

但在dev-server.js中的exports是返回給node.js嗎?node.js會(huì)如何使用返回的readyPromise?

node.js - 在vuejs-templates/webpack中dev-server.js里為什么要exports readyPromise?

vuejs-templates/webpack的地址為:https://github.com/vuejs-temp...

問題解答

回答1:

這里導(dǎo)出readyPromise的目的在于提供了一個(gè)鉤子給用戶在webpack打包完成后執(zhí)行自定義的操作,你可以在一個(gè)腳本中引入dev-server.js的導(dǎo)出,

//custom.jslet devServer = require(’dev-server.js’)devServer.then(()=>{ //執(zhí)行自定義的操作})

在packge.json中將原先的start任務(wù)內(nèi)容替換為'node build/dev-server.js',這樣npm run start時(shí)會(huì)執(zhí)行自定義的操作

標(biāo)簽: vue
相關(guān)文章:
主站蜘蛛池模板: 穆棱市| 汝城县| 松阳县| 哈密市| 沁阳市| 南木林县| 沿河| 云龙县| 浮山县| 长顺县| 哈尔滨市| 菏泽市| 中卫市| 枞阳县| 文安县| 湘潭县| 海盐县| 大姚县| 清流县| 若尔盖县| 嵊泗县| 浏阳市| 屏山县| 化德县| 乐安县| 元谋县| 湾仔区| 邯郸市| 长岭县| 原平市| 龙海市| 鄂尔多斯市| 剑川县| 洞口县| 土默特左旗| 岗巴县| 边坝县| 枣阳市| 长子县| 嘉峪关市| 碌曲县|